It tracks time in HH:MM:SS (12/24-hour) and date in YY-MM-DD-dd format, includes alarm, square-wave output, and Y2K compliance. The through-hole 24-DIP module (0.600-inch body) is socket-friendly — a part you can swap on site with a chip puller and no hot air. ## Supply range and battery backup Runs from a 2.7 V to 3.7 V main supply, with a separate battery input accepting 2.5 V to 3.7 V. Timekeeping current draws 2 mA max at 3 V — modest for a parallel RTC with embedded NVSRAM. The pinout and function are identical; the main difference is the supply voltage range (2.7 V to 3.7 V for the -3+ vs 4.5 V to 5.5 V for the DS1687). If your board was designed for the 5 V part, you will need to drop the main rail to 3.3 V or lower and ensure the battery voltage is within 2.5 V to 3.7 V."},{"question":"What battery voltage does the DS1687-3+ require?","answer":"The battery backup input accepts 2.5 V to 3.7 V. A standard 3 V lithium coin cell (CR2032) works directly. Do not use a 5 V backup battery — it exceeds the maximum rating."}],"compareFactBullets":[],"relatedMpns":[],"engineerNotes":[],"selectionNotes":null,"limitations":null},"provenance":{"sourceSystem":"icboms-matrix-langgraph","citationUrl":"https://icboms.com/analog-devices/DS1687-3","citationPolicyUrl":"https://icboms.com/llms.txt","source":"ICBOMS","attribution":"Open for AI and search answers: credit \"ICBOMS\" and link https://icboms.com/analog-devices/DS1687-3 when reusing this data.
